Burkinabé Sculptor Abdoulaye Gandema Reveals Bronze Casting Secrets: 'I've Been Working Bronze with My Father Since Age 7'

Internationally renowned Burkinabé sculptor Abdoulaye Gandema is set to demonstrate his exceptional bronze-working techniques at an upcoming arts and crafts fair in Chalais, France. The master craftsman, who has dedicated his life to perfecting the ancient art of bronze sculpture, will be among the featured artists showcasing their skills at the prestigious event.

Gandema's journey into the world of bronze sculpting began at an remarkably early age. "Since I was 7 years old, I've been working with bronze alongside my father," the sculptor revealed, highlighting the deeply rooted family tradition that has shaped his artistic career. This early introduction to the craft has allowed him to develop an intimate understanding of bronze as a medium and master techniques that have been passed down through generations.

The artist is particularly celebrated for his expertise in the lost-wax casting technique, a complex and ancient method of bronze casting that requires exceptional skill and precision. This traditional process, known as "cire perdue" in French, involves creating a wax model that is later encased in clay or plaster, heated to melt away the wax, and then filled with molten bronze to create the final sculpture. Gandema's mastery of this technique has earned him international recognition and established him as one of the most respected practitioners of this ancient art form.

During his demonstration at the Chalais arts and crafts salon, visitors will have the rare opportunity to witness Gandema's techniques firsthand and gain insight into the intricate processes involved in bronze sculpture. The event promises to be an educational experience for art enthusiasts, aspiring sculptors, and anyone interested in traditional craftsmanship. Gandema's work is particularly noted for his artistic focus on sculpting feminine forms, showcasing his ability to capture grace and beauty in bronze through his refined techniques and artistic vision.
